diff --git a/src/applications/repository/graphcache/PhabricatorRepositoryGraphCache.php b/src/applications/repository/graphcache/PhabricatorRepositoryGraphCache.php new file mode 100644 index 0000000000..303b5b83f2 --- /dev/null +++ b/src/applications/repository/graphcache/PhabricatorRepositoryGraphCache.php @@ -0,0 +1,386 @@ + -- + * + * ...routinely takes several hundred milliseconds, and equivalent requests + * often take longer in Mercurial. + * + * Unfortunately, this operation is fundamental to rendering a repository for + * the web, and essentially everything else that's slow can be reduced to this + * plus some trivial work afterward. Making this fast is desirable and powerful, + * and allows us to make other things fast by expressing them in terms of this + * query. + * + * Because the query is fundamentally a graph query, it isn't easy to express + * in a reasonable way in MySQL, and we can't do round trips to the server to + * walk the graph without incurring huge performance penalties. + * + * However, the total amount of data in the graph is relatively small. By + * caching it in chunks and keeping it in APC, we can reasonably load and walk + * the graph in PHP quickly. + * + * For more context, see T2683. + * + * Structure of the Cache + * ====================== + * + * The cache divides commits into buckets (see @{method:getBucketSize}). To + * walk the graph, we pull a commit's bucket. The bucket is a map from commit + * IDs to a list of parents and changed paths, separated by `null`. For + * example, a bucket might look like this: + * + * array( + * 1 => array(0, null, 17, 18), + * 2 => array(1, null, 4), + * // ... + * ) + * + * This means that commit ID 1 has parent commit 0 (a special value meaning + * no parents) and affected path IDs 17 and 18. Commit ID 2 has parent commit 1, + * and affected path 4. + * + * This data structure attempts to balance compactness, ease of construction, + * simplicity of cache semantics, and lookup performance. In the average case, + * it appears to do a reasonable job at this. + * + * @task query Querying the Graph Cache + * @task cache Cache Internals + */ +final class PhabricatorRepositoryGraphCache { + + +/* -( Querying the Graph Cache )------------------------------------------- */ + + + /** + * Search the graph cache for the most modification to a path. + * + * @param int The commit ID to search ancestors of. + * @param int The path ID to search for changes to. + * @param float Maximum number of seconds to spend trying to satisfy this + * query using the graph cache.
